Quixtar is the United States branch of a company called Amway. Amway operates all over the world but has adopted a different name to use while operating in the states.

Quixtar is a multi level marketing business. Their products include beauty products, vitamins and food supplements, water purifying systems, and laundry detergent. When you become a representative of the company, you earn commissions when any of Quixtar’s products are purchased, whether they are from yourself or others. Furthermore, as you enroll others into the business and THEY buy and sell Quixtar products, you receive a commission for those transactions as well.

Agel is a relatively young company, having been established 3 years ago in 2005. They launched in 12 countries and have expanded into 18 more since then. Their products fall into the health and wellness market which is currently a $300 billion dollar industry.

There are 4 different products that Agel offers. They are named min, ohm, fit, and exo. Min is nutrient rich and provides the body with necessary vitamins and minerals. Ohm gives the body energy. Fit is an appetite controller and helps individuals maintain their cravings. And lastly exo is an antioxidizing product that helps clean the system.

Let’s start at the beginning. ACN is a telecommunications company that is based out of Detroit, Michigan. The products they offer are home telephone service, cell phone service, Direct TV, VOIP telephone service, and their bread and butter: the VIDEO PHONE.

They pay out commissions in three different ways: personal residual income, overriding residual income, and bonuses. The personal residual comes from customers that you acquire yourself whether they are family, friends, or even strangers. They claim that you can receive up to 10% of the total billing of your customer base, but to reach that tier your total billing has to be upwards of $10,000. So basically, personal residual income equals pennies on the dollar and is ALWAYS insignificant to the new representative.

Overriding residual income is much more substantial than personal residual income. It comes from the customer base of individuals who have joined ACN and are on your team. When you refer friends or family to ACN and they join, a percentage of the customer billing they create is considered your “overriding residual income.” However, the amount of money that you receive is dependent on a number of factors. Finally, the most important source of income for ACN representatives: team customer acquisition bonuses, otherwise known as TCAB’s. These are bonuses that are received when your organization grows. The amounts of these bonuses vary heavily since it is dependent on a number of factors. Put simply, when you or someone on your team signs up a new representative it counts towards your bonus for that given month. Depending on how many new sign ups occurred in a month for your organization, a certain bonus is paid. You basically get paid when you recruit new individuals into your business and when you acquire customers.
